In a dramatic Game 2 of the Eastern Conference playoffs, the Boston Celtics faced off against the Orlando Magic, marking a significant moment in the career of Celtics superstar Jason Tatum. Tatum, who has been a cornerstone of the Celtics’ lineup, experienced a notable setback as he sat out the game due to a wrist injury, ending his impressive playoff streak of 114 consecutive games played.

With Tatum sidelined, the spotlight shifted to his teammates, particularly Jaylen Brown, who stepped up to fill the void. Brown put on a remarkable performance, scoring double figures in the first quarter alone, demonstrating his capability to lead the team in the absence of their star player. The Celtics took an early lead, but the Magic remained in contention, showcasing a competitive spirit throughout the game.

As the first quarter concluded, the Celtics held a slight edge over the Magic, with the score at 23-21. The second quarter saw Orlando’s Anthony Black make a significant impact with a powerful dunk that energized the crowd, while Boston’s Tatum’s absence became increasingly palpable. However, the Celtics responded with an efficient performance, highlighted by Brown’s 14 points and a shooting percentage of 60% from the field.

The third quarter witnessed a back-and-forth battle, with Boston managing to take a narrow lead. Brown continued to shine, hitting back-to-back three-pointers to push the Celtics ahead. Despite a determined effort from Orlando, led by standout performances, Boston maintained their composure and extended their lead, ending the third quarter at 81-71.

In the final quarter, Brown’s contributions were crucial. He added eight more points, including a crucial three-pointer that solidified Boston’s lead. The Celtics’ depth shone through as Payton Pritchard also made significant contributions, including an impressive “and-one” play that further propelled the Celtics toward victory.

Ultimately, the Boston Celtics emerged victorious, overcoming the challenge posed by the Orlando Magic with a final score that reflected their resilience and teamwork, even in the face of adversity due to Tatum’s injury. This game not only showcased the Celtics’ depth but also highlighted the potential for younger players to rise to the occasion in critical moments. As the series progresses, all eyes will be on Tatum’s recovery and how the Celtics adapt to the shifting dynamics of their lineup.
